I make tags/labels quite a bit because my hubby is retired, but has lots of stuff at home that he still works on.
My first thought would be to make sure that the content part of your tag is very visible and readable, at a glance, like you said. For this type of thing I like to use my printer and a simple font. I enlarge it really big and usually "bold" it.
You could do this on white cardstock, and then add something cute and appealing on the end by stamping and coloring in bright colors.
